2961 NW 24th Ct, Ft Lauderdale, FL 33311-2825

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 33311:
542 Nw 12th Ave, Ft Lauderdale, FL 33311
3034 Nw 33rd Ave, Lauderdale Lakes, FL 33311
2600 Nw 21st St, Ft Lauderdale, FL 33311
831 Nw 13th Ave, Ft Lauderdale, FL 33311
1775 Nw 16th Ct, Ft Lauderdale, FL 33311